Output dd60f9792bc48f58bed071877618b635aa8debdac66ca9e2a7baa3ec6dcf3f1e:6

value
12722644
script pubkey
OP_0 OP_PUSHBYTES_20 ebf3464d1e2e7a5a36a41af9dc1a016f08091da0
address
bc1qa0e5vng79ea95d4yrtuacxspduyqj8dql8zgzu
transaction
dd60f9792bc48f58bed071877618b635aa8debdac66ca9e2a7baa3ec6dcf3f1e
confirmations
91909
spent
true